  "account": "The WNBA is experiencing a surge in viewership and attendance, with the All-Star Game drawing more fans than the NBA's All-Star Game. However, recent discussions surrounding the league have been dominated by right-wing attacks targeting transgender individuals in sports. Enes Kanter Freedom, a retired NBA player, wore a shirt at a WNBA game that sparked controversy. Angela Perry, a WNBA content creator, and Katelyn Burns, a journalist, discussed how the league has become a focal point for right-wing misinformation. They explained that the right-wing is using trans rights issues as a means to keep the controversy front and center, especially leading up to the midterm elections.",
